KCC Institute of Legal and Higher Education BCom (Hons.) fee may have many components. The tuition fee charged by the institute is INR 95,000 per year. So, the total tuition fee for 3 years is INR 2.85 lakh. The annual hostel fee ranges from INR 1.01 lakh to INR 1.98 lakh. Security deposit of INR 5000 also has to be paid by students to avail hostel facility.

Eligibility criteria for admission in BCom (Hons) at KCC Institute of Legal and Higher Education is mentioned below:

  • For admission through Management Quota: Minimum 50% (45% for SC/ST/PWD candidates) in Class 12 with English as a subject.
  • For admission through NTA CUET: Eligibility criteria as prescribed by NTA.

The selection criteria for admission in BCom (Hons) at KCC Institute of Legal and Higher Education is mentioned below:

  • Through Management Quota: Rank in GGSIPU CET.
  • Through NTA CUET: Merit in NTA CUET.
